Narration is a child retelling the story in his/her own words.

Dictation is the teacher dictating a sentence (saying a sentence/phrase) to the child, and the child writing it down. Remembering proper captialization, puncutation, spelling, etc...

Charlotte Mason uses dictation as a very effective tool for spelling.

It's like Christine says. :D You have the child study the passage first and then when they are ready you say it to them sentence by sentence or phrase by phrase pausing for them to write and they write what they hear and remember of the spelling and punctuation trying to copy it exactly as they say it in the passage. If they miss anything they then study that passage again and repeat it before they move on to another until they can get it correct.
